The 9102 determines the adjacent channels by the channel width and
channel spacing input parameters (see sections “Changing the channel
spacing” and “Changing the channel width” on page 78). It displays the
numerical results of the adjacent channel power ratio measurements
for the left (lower) and right (upper) channels on the top-left. The
measured bands are indicated graphically with bandwidth boundaries
shown in red.
Occupied bandwidth
(OBW)
The occupied bandwidth identifies the frequency range into which a
given percentage of the signal power falls. The frequency range is not
necessarily symmetric around the center frequency but is selected so
that the bandwidth to hold a certain user-defined OBW percentage is
minimized. See section “Changing the occupied bandwidth
percentage” on page 78.
OBW is indicated as an absolute value in the upper left-hand corner of
the display, together with the OBW percentage; marker A1 and delta
marker DA2 are assigned the lower and upper frequencies character-
izing the frequency range. The power is measured over three times the
normal channel bandwidth. The red boundary indicators mark the
normal channel bandwidth as selected in the Channel System menu.
